The UK Compliance team, part of the Risk and Intelligent Automation function, ensures compliance with regulations and customer outcomes. The Marketing Manager role within the evoke Compliance function ensures that all marketing activities meet legal and industry standards in the UK. This fast-paced role requires a deep understanding of gambling marketing regulations and excellent communication and stakeholder management skills. The company offers flexibility, trust, and investment in personal and professional development.

What you will be doing

  • Ensure all marketing communications and campaigns comply with regulatory requirements.
  • Review and advise on campaigns and marketing materials.
  • Collaborate with stakeholders, including the Data Protection Office, to ensure compliance with GDPR.
  • Develop and coach others to raise awareness of best practices for marketing compliance.
  • Create policies and procedures to ensure marketing compliance.
  • Establish processes to monitor compliance across marketing campaigns.
  • Identify and manage risks in marketing activities, keeping stakeholders updated.
  • Stay informed on regulatory changes and best practices to maintain compliance.

Who we are looking for

  • In-depth knowledge of UK gambling regulations and marketing requirements (LCCP, CAP code, Industry codes, ASA guidelines).
  • Strong attention to detail and ability to analyze data for informed recommendations.
  • Excellent interpersonal and stakeholder management skills, with the ability to build relationships across the organization.
  • Exemplary communication skills, with sound judgment and the ability to take initiative, apply reasoning, and make actionable recommendations.
